## GraphPeek: collapse noisy edges by default

Quick one before the sync: GraphPeek's dependency visualizer was rendering every transitive edge, which made the Kestrel monorepo view basically unreadable. This PR collapses edges below a weight threshold and adds a toggle to expand them. Layout time on the big graph dropped from ~9s to under 2s. Defaults come from the tuning constants below.

tuning table, yajog-yahof:
BUDGETS = {
    "lamvan": 303,
    "wenox": 460,
    "fenvan": 525,
}

Release checklist — Gustline Weather Fan-Out. Before sign-off, verify the fan-out service delivers a test alert to all three regional queues within the 90-second SLA, and confirm dedup keys prevent double-sends when the upstream feed retries. Check that the throttle config matches the values in the current release manifest, not last quarter's defaults. If any queue lags, escalate before tagging. Once all checks pass, paste your results into the release thread along with the trace token shown below.

session token of yajof-bagef = htk4_937d

## Baseline Limits

The static-analysis baseline file for the Quellstrom linter caps how many suppressed findings each module may carry. If a module exceeds its quota, CI fails and the owning team must either fix findings or request a quota bump via the Harkwell review board. Do not edit the baseline by hand. The current tuning constants are as follows.

tuning constants:
BUDGETS = {
    "druath": 240,
    "lamwyn": 180,
    "silael": 275,
}

TICKET-4182: The driver-assignment heuristic in Routewise occasionally selects drivers outside their permitted zone when two candidates share identical proximity scores. The tiebreaker falls through to raw list order, which is attacker-influenceable via crafted availability updates. Fix constrains the tiebreak to zone-validated candidates only. The patched build is referenced below for verification.

build token for fahap-yagag: htk3_d09